Garda Reform and Related Issues: Discussion
Mr. Drew Harris:
Undoubtedly, with population growth and the anticipated growth in housing and commerce outside traditional areas in the next five to ten years, there is no doubt that there will be a case for the opening of additional stations, but at present we have enough working parts without my picking at it. As we have a pretty complicated ongoing review of recommendations, I am loath to start another plate spinning.
At the same time, however, I think there is a case. Some areas are set to grow exponentially in the next few years.
